Technical background 
Traditional 
function 
generators 
SFG-2000 series uses the latest Direct Digital Synthesis 
(DDS) technology to generate stable, high resolution 
output frequency. The DDS technology solves several 
problems encountered in traditional function generators, 
as follows. 
Constant current circuit methodology 
This analog function generating method uses a constant 
current source circuit built with discrete components 
such as capacitors and resistors. Temperature change 
inside the generator greatly affects the components 
characteristics which lead to output frequency change. 
The results are poor accuracy and stability. 
DDS 
methodology 
In DDS, the waveform data is contained in and 
generated from a memory. A clock controls the counter 
which points to the data address. The memory output is 
converted into analog signal by a digital to analog 
converter (DAC) followed by a low pass filter. The 
resolution is expressed as fs/2k where fs is the frequency 
and k is the control word, which contains more than 
28bits. Because the frequency generation is referred to 
clock signal, this achieves much higher frequency stability 
and resolution than the traditional function generators.
